Try this, open MY COMPUTER > TOOLS > FOLDER OPTIONS > VIEW, scroll to the bottom and tick ENABLE SIMPLE FILE SHARING, restart and try again.

Goto any folders u want to share and right click , select SHARING AND SECURITY, click on the Hypertext 'If u understand....blah blah" then select 'JUST ENABLE".
